Nancy Krulik

    1 janvier 1961

    Nancy Krulik est reconnue pour son œuvre considérable, comprenant plus d'une centaine de livres pour enfants et jeunes adultes, acquérant une renommée particulière pour sa captivante série mettant en scène Katie Kazoo. Son écriture résonne souvent profondément auprès des jeunes lecteurs, explorant des thèmes pertinents pour leurs expériences. Par ailleurs, Krulik a créé de nombreuses œuvres pour adolescents, s'établissant comme biographe de stars hollywoodiennes émergentes. Son intuition aiguisée sur la vie des célébrités l'a amenée à apparaître fréquemment dans des émissions de divertissement. Elle a également contribué au genre des livres de conseils pour adolescents, abordant un large éventail de sujets pertinents pour la vie des jeunes.
